Share Your Holiday Cheer
It's a common tale: We snap picture after picture at holiday gatherings--office holiday parties, big family dinners, gift exchanges, what have you. But, alas, more often than we'd like, our snaps don’t see the light of day as often as we'd like. That's where a digital photo frame comes into play. This 8-inch frame from Pandigital is one of our favorites: Packing 64MB of onboard memory, various slide show options, and excellent photo quality, it’s a perfect choice.

Rockin' Around the Christmas Tree
Everyone loves a good video game, and, it seems, everyone loves Guitar Hero, too. This holiday season, Guitar Hero III: Legends of Rock hits store shelves for just about every platform imaginable, offering more songs and features not seen in the first two incarnations. (The Wii
features are especially cool.) A bundle consisting of the game and wireless controller is sure to please the music lover and gamer on your list.

Dell's Tree-Topping PC
All-in-one PCs are on course to become the go-to machines for users seeking a simple, home PC for general family use. First, naturally, there was the Apple iMac, then came the Gateway One. The Dell XPS One leaves the others in the dust. Except for the graphics
choice, the XPS One uses components that are competitive with those found in traditionally designed desktop tower PCs with a bright 20-inch widescreen display.

Holiday Tunes That Ring True
Seems like everyone's holiday wish list includes some new gadget or gizmo for listening to music, watching movies or TV, or playing video games. And with all those new toys comes a lot of sound--sound that you want to be crisp and clear, proving how important a great pair of headphones can be. The Denon AH-D1000 headphones will feed your hunger for deep bass and can work on the quieter audio as well.
